Why and How to have Two Robotic Arms Working Together in an Injection Automation System?
The injection molding automation system of which will need two top entry robotic arms working together are mostly a system of in mold insertion or assembly or packing. With two injection robotic arms working together the automation system will finish a complex process like to have one robotic arm pick the parts A from injection molding machine A and the other robotic arm have the Parts A inserted into the injection molding machine B.
What's the Ideology of SWITEK Wheel Injection Automation Solutions?
The SWITEK wheel injection automation solution is a representative solution of multi-components injection molding of which the core and the outring of the wheels are produced of different materials. The ideology of the automation system is that the core of wheels are injection molded by injection molding machine A and robot A will pick the core out and placed on the to be furtherr cooled and quality checked by the vision control system; the robotic arm B will pick the quality core and insert it into the injection molding machine B for outring injection molding and pick out the finished wheels to be placed on the conveyor.
Is there Any Other Solutions of Multi-Components Parts Injection Molding?
For multi-components injection molding the other solution is to use a two-tone injection molding machine of which the mold will switch the position for the soft-plastic injection molding after the hard plastic core injection molding.
What's the Difference Between SWITEK Two Robotic Arms Solutions and Multi-Components Injection Molding Machine Solutions?
The SWITEK two robotic arms in mold inertion system has the injection molding of the hard plastic core and the soft plastic outring of the wheel done by two injection molding machines, the system is much more complex. But with this system the core will have a better cooling and after quality checking before the soft plastic injection, it'll have a better quality control of the final products.
For sure it would be much more easier to have the injection molding of both the hard plastic core and the soft plastic outring done by the same injection molding machine, but it'll request a perfect chilling system in the mold design and in case there's any defect in the hard plastic core injection molding, a defect wheel would be produced and difficult to be find out because the core is wrapped by the soft plastic after the second injection molding.

PVC pipe fittings are one of the most commonly used connector in the drainage project and a cold runner designed mold is the most economic solutions for the production of the PVC pipe fittings, but the removal of the runner in result is a labour intensive work. Is there any economic way to remove the runners from the PVC pipe fittings automatically?
For the producer of PVC pipe fittings the most economic soluton to remove the runner is with an Air Nipper fixed to the picking robot immediately after the PVC pipe fittings picked out from the mould. The robot will drop the seperated pipe fittings and runner to different containers. Below configuration of SWITEK runner cutting solution for 16 cavities PVC pipe fittings for your reference:
The Air Nipper runner cutting system is an easy to start solution for the producers of PVC pipe fittings, which the Air Nipper would be controlled by the picking robot and is the best solution for the small size PVC pipe fittings (with a diameter around φ25mm). Anyway it also must be custom made according to the mold design.
